SENIOR FRONTEND ENGINEER

We are looking for a Senior Frontend Engineer to join a highly skilled team building global customer data platforms. You’ll play a key role in rebuilding and modernizing legacy systems using current frontend technologies, contributing to a data platform used across critical systems.

REQUIRED SKILLS AND EXPERIENCE

  • 10+ years of experience in software development, preferably in large-scale applications
  • Expert-level knowledge of JavaScript (Vanilla JS), CSS, HTML, and Web Components
  • Solid experience with Node.js, frontend build tools (Webpack, Rollup), and browser APIs
  • Familiarity with class-based components (e.g., React Classes, LIT)
  • Experience designing APIs and working in cross-functional environments
  • Strong understanding of frontend architecture, SPA, and SSR/SSG patterns
  • Proficiency in CI/CD pipelines (preferably Azure DevOps)
  • Solid grasp of TDD/BDD and frontend testing frameworks (Mocha, Chai, Selenium, etc.)
  • Clear communication skills and ability to work in agile, collaborative teams

ABOUT THE ROLE

You’ll be part of a multidisciplinary team responsible for developing and maintaining a global reference data platform. This platform supports consistent customer and business data across international systems, enabling standardized regulatory reporting, risk calculations, and system integrations. As a Senior Frontend Engineer, your focus will be on replacing and improving the existing frontend with scalable, modern, and performant architecture.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Lead the development of frontend components using modern JavaScript standards
  • Rebuild legacy frontends with clean, efficient, and reusable code
  • Contribute to frontend architecture decisions and implementation
  • Design API integrations with performance and usability in mind
  • Help establish and follow consistent coding standards and CI/CD processes
  • Collaborate closely with backend engineers, product owners, and stakeholders
  • Contribute to testing strategies (unit, integration, E2E) and ensure high-quality deliverables
  • Support the platform through deployment, monitoring, and maintenance activities
